Key Concepts and Overview

Protecting ETH wallets involves several core concepts that every user should be aware of. First, it’s essential to understand the different types of wallets available: hot wallets, which are connected to the internet, and cold wallets, which are offline. Each type has its advantages and disadvantages regarding accessibility and security. Additionally, users must be familiar with the various threats that exist, such as phishing attacks, malware, and social engineering tactics that hackers employ to gain access to wallets.

Another crucial aspect is the importance of private keys. These keys are what allow users to access their funds, and if compromised, can lead to significant losses. Therefore, safeguarding these keys is paramount in protecting ETH wallets.

Main Features and Details

To effectively protect ETH wallets, several features and practices should be implemented. One of the most effective methods is the use of hardware wallets, which store private keys offline, making them less susceptible to online threats. These devices often come with additional security features such as PIN codes and recovery phrases, adding layers of protection.

Another important practice is enabling two-factor authentication (2FA) on any platform that supports it. This adds an extra step for verification, making it more difficult for unauthorized users to access wallets. Additionally, users should regularly update their software and wallets to ensure they have the latest security patches and features.

Education plays a vital role in wallet protection. Users should be aware of common scams and how to recognize them. Regularly reviewing security practices and staying informed about new threats can significantly reduce the risk of hacks.

Practical Examples and Use Cases

Consider a scenario where an industry analyst is advising a client on how to secure their ETH investments. They might recommend starting with a hardware wallet for long-term storage of assets, while using a hot wallet for day-to-day transactions. This hybrid approach allows for both security and convenience.

Another example could involve a company that regularly conducts transactions in Ethereum. Implementing strict access controls and requiring 2FA for all employees handling crypto assets can help mitigate risks. Additionally, conducting regular security audits can identify potential vulnerabilities before they are exploited.

Advantages and Disadvantages

When discussing the advantages of securing ETH wallets, one must consider the peace of mind that comes with knowing your assets are protected. Hardware wallets, for example, offer a high level of security and are less prone to hacks compared to online wallets. Furthermore, implementing security measures like 2FA can significantly reduce the risk of unauthorized access.

However, there are also disadvantages to consider. Hardware wallets can be costly and may not be as convenient for frequent transactions. Additionally, if a user loses their hardware wallet or forgets their recovery phrase, they may permanently lose access to their funds. Balancing security and accessibility is crucial for users.

Additional Insights

In addition to the standard practices of securing ETH wallets, there are some edge cases and expert tips that can further enhance security. For instance, users should be cautious about sharing their screen during virtual meetings, as sensitive information could be inadvertently exposed. It’s also advisable to use unique passwords for different accounts and to store them securely using a password manager.

Another important note is to be wary of public Wi-Fi networks when accessing wallets. Using a Virtual Private Network (VPN) can help secure connections and protect against potential eavesdropping. Lastly, staying updated on the latest security trends and threats in the cryptocurrency space can provide users with the knowledge needed to adapt their security measures accordingly.
